Survivability-based Scheduling Algorithm for Bag-of-Tasks Applications with Deadline Constraints on Grids

被引:0
|
作者
Wang, Shupeng [1 ]
Hin, Xiaochun [1 ]
Yu, Xiangzhan [1 ]
机构
[1] Harbin Inst Technol, Sch Comp Sci & Technol, Harbin 150001, Heilongjiang, Peoples R China
关键词
Grid scheduling; survivability; bag-of-tasks application; deadline;
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In the dynamic, complex and unbounded Grid systems, failures of Grid resources caused by malicious attacks and hardware failures are inevitable and can have an adverse effect on the execution of applications. Therefore it becomes an important and difficult issue to guarantee that the applications execute normally in Grid environment. To alleviate this problem, the survivability-driven scheduling algorithms are proposed in our previous work. However these algorithms don't consider the deadline requirements of users. In this paper, we propose a Survivability-Based scheduling algorithm for bag-of-tasks applications with Deadline Constraints that maximizes the survivability while meeting the deadline for delivering results, which is referred as SBDC algorithm. Compared with traditional scheduling algorithms, this algorithm is more adaptable to the complex Grid computing environment. Experimental results reveal that this algorithm can maximize the survivability of applications while meeting the application deadline.
引用
下载
收藏
页码:13 / 18
页数:6
相关论文
共 50 条
  • [1] An Improved Genetic Algorithm for Solving Bag-of-tasks Scheduling Problems with Deadline Constraints on Hybrid Clouds
    Mao, Jingjing
    Sun, Lulu
    Zhang, Yi
    Sun, Jin
    PROCEEDINGS OF THE 2018 IEEE INTERNATIONAL CONFERENCE ON PROGRESS IN INFORMATICS AND COMPUTING (PIC), 2018, : 305 - 310
  • [2] Power aware scheduling of bag-of-tasks applications with deadline constraints on DVS-enabled clusters
    Kim, Kyong Hoon
    Buyya, Rajkumar
    Kim, Jong
    CCGRID 2007: SEVENTH IEEE INTERNATIONAL SYMPOSIUM ON CLUSTER COMPUTING AND THE GRID, 2007, : 541 - +
  • [3] Practical scheduling of bag-of-tasks applications on grids with dynamic resilience
    Lee, Young Choon
    Zomaya, Albert Y.
    IEEE TRANSACTIONS ON COMPUTERS, 2007, 56 (06) : 815 - 825
  • [4] Scheduling Bag-of-Tasks applications with Budget constraints on Hybrid Clouds
    Zhang, Yi
    Sun, Jin
    Wu, Zebin
    Chen, Li
    2018 SIXTH INTERNATIONAL CONFERENCE ON ADVANCED CLOUD AND BIG DATA (CBD), 2018, : 12 - 17
  • [5] Fault-aware scheduling for Bag-of-Tasks applications on Desktop Grids
    Anglano, Cosimo
    Brevik, John
    Canonico, Massimo
    Nurmi, Dan
    Wolski, Rich
    2006 7TH IEEE/ACM INTERNATIONAL CONFERENCE ON GRID COMPUTING, 2006, : 56 - +
  • [6] A Novel Firefly Algorithm for Scheduling Bag-of-Tasks Applications Under Budget Constraints on Hybrid Clouds
    Zhang, Yi
    Zhou, Junlong
    Sun, Lulu
    Mao, Jingjing
    Sun, Jin
    IEEE ACCESS, 2019, 7 : 151888 - 151901
  • [7] Bag-of-Tasks Applications Scheduling on Volunteer Desktop Grids with Adaptive Information Dissemination
    Kwan, Shun Kit
    Muppala, Jogesh K.
    IEEE LOCAL COMPUTER NETWORK CONFERENCE, 2010, : 544 - 551
  • [8] Toward a Fully Decentralized Algorithm for Multiple Bag-of-tasks Application Scheduling on Grids
    Bertin, Remi
    Legrand, Arnaud
    Touati, Corinne
    2008 9TH IEEE/ACM INTERNATIONAL CONFERENCE ON GRID COMPUTING, 2008, : 118 - 125
  • [9] Requirement-Aware Scheduling of Bag-of-Tasks Applications on Grids with Dynamic Resilience
    Hu, Menglan
    Veeravalli, Bharadwaj
    IEEE TRANSACTIONS ON COMPUTERS, 2013, 62 (10) : 2108 - 2114
  • [10] Offer-based Scheduling of Deadline-Constrained Bag-of-Tasks Applications for Utility Computing Systems
    Netto, Marco A. S.
    Buyya, Rajkumar
    2009 IEEE INTERNATIONAL SYMPOSIUM ON PARALLEL & DISTRIBUTED PROCESSING, VOLS 1-5, 2009, : 1422 - 1432